Practical Embroidery Notes Before You Stitch

I always give my students and clients a few non-negotiable steps before they stitch any newembroidery file. Here is what I recommend for Simple Tee Shirt with Playful Mono 9:

  1. Test on scrap fabric first. Do not skip this step. Stitch it on a piece of fabric similar to your final product. Check the stitch quality, the density, and the overall look.
  2. Check thread color contrast. Hold your thread next to the fabric in natural light. If the contrast is weak, the design will look muddy. Adjust the thread color before you stitch the final product.
  3. Review stitch density. If your machine allows, inspect thefill stitch andsatin stitch areas. If the density is too high for your fabric, reduce it slightly. Too low, and the design will look sparse.
  4. Confirm hoop size. Make sure the design fits comfortably within your hoop with room to spare. Crowding the hoop can cause registration issues.
  5. Inspect small details. Zoom in on the design file. Look at therunning stitch outlines and thesatin stitch edges. They should be smooth and even.
  6. Test in black and white mockups. Convert the design to grayscale or black and white to see how the value contrast works. This helps you spot areas that might blend together.
  7. Compare light and dark fabric backgrounds. Stitch the same design on a light fabric and a dark fabric. See how the design reads on each. This will guide your product offerings.
  8. Use proper stabilizer. For most garments, a tear-away or cutaway stabilizer works well. For stretchy fabrics, always use cutaway. For dense stitch areas, use a heavier stabilizer.
  9. Check licensing before selling. Since this is an SVG file listed underCrafts andGraphics, confirm whether you can use it forcommercial embroidery and selling finished products. If the license is not clear, contact the seller before you list anything.
  10. Test washability. Stitch the design on a swatch and wash it according to the care instructions of your final product. Check for thread breakage, puckering, or fading.

These steps might seem like extra work, but they save you from ruining a good product. I have seen too manyhobbyists andcreative entrepreneurs skip the test run and end up with a batch of unsellable items. Do not let that happen to you.
